Aircheck: WBPM - Cool 92.9 - The Last Shows

I was listening to Cool 92.9 today that all three of these jocks are gone from that station, because WBPM is flipping to classic hits according to All Access. I missed oldies so much, it was a great format. :( I left the radio on when I left for work to record it on DVD burner to hear the last hour of Rick McCaffery and Tony Flash on that station. When I came home, I record the last 30 minutes of Rick Knight along with his famous last sign-off made by Allan Sniffen of "Board Reflections" and the NYRMB. This was one great show after another. Later on, I will record the aircheck of the format flip. All this and more I will be posting it by tomorrow.

I'm so sad to see the station go. Rick McCaffery goes to WKIP this Friday for the "Solid Gold Jukebox" and Tony Flash will go to WCZR's "Cruisin' 93.5" to do weekends, it's the end of oldies in the Hudson Valley. Will have to post it tomorrow.
